A dynamic workforce solutions provider is seeking a POS / Print Category Manager in the United Kingdom. This remote role requires a strategic thinker with strong interpersonal skills, responsible for developing sourcing strategies for Temporary Point of Sale products.
Key responsibilities include:
- Conducting market research
- Negotiating with suppliers
- Collaborating with various teams
The ideal candidate should have in-depth market knowledge and proven experience in strategic sourcing. Competitive salary plus bonuses offered.
